Keto Crispy Reuben Roll-Ups Recipe

Keto Crispy Reuben Roll-Ups are a delicious, low-carb snack that combines savory corned beef, tangy sauerkraut, and melty Swiss cheese, all wrapped up and baked to golden perfection. Perfect for those following a keto lifestyle or anyone craving a guilt-free savory treat, these roll-ups are easy to prepare and offer a satisfying crispy texture.

Ingredients

Scale

Main Ingredients

  • 8 oz Corned Beef (Savory protein; substitute with roasted mushrooms or tempeh for a vegetarian option.)
  • 4 slices Swiss Cheese (Can be swapped for Gouda, Monterey Jack, or cheddar.)
  • 1 cup Sauerkraut (Adds tanginess.)
  • 2 large Eggs (Acts as a binder.)
  • 2 tbsp Mustard (Ensure to choose a gluten-free variety if needed.)
  • 1 cup Pickles (Add a nice crunch; consider dill pickles for a zesty kick.)
  • 1 Jalapeño (Spice things up for those who love heat.)

Instructions

  1. Preheat Oven: Set your oven to 375°F (190°C) to ensure a perfect baking temperature for crispy roll-ups.
  2. Prepare Ingredients: Lay out your corned beef, cheese slices, and sauerkraut on a clean, flat surface to prepare for assembly.
  3. Assemble Roll-Ups: Place a slice of Swiss cheese on top of each slice of corned beef, add a spoonful of sauerkraut, then carefully roll each one tightly and secure with a toothpick to hold the shape.
  4. Coat with Egg: Beat the eggs in a shallow dish and dip each roll-up into the eggs, ensuring they are completely coated to help achieve a crispy exterior when baked.
  5. Bake: Arrange the roll-ups on a baking sheet lined with parchment paper or lightly greased and bake them in the preheated oven for 12 minutes, or until they are golden brown and crispy on the outside.
  6. Optional Air Frying: For a quicker and crispier option, you can air fry the roll-ups at 375°F for 8-10 minutes, turning halfway through for even cooking.

Notes

  • For a vegetarian version, substitute corned beef with roasted mushrooms or tempeh.
  • You can swap Swiss cheese with Gouda, Monterey Jack, or cheddar based on preference.
  • Use gluten-free mustard to keep the recipe gluten-free.
  • Adding jalapeños provides a spicy kick, but omit for a milder flavor.
  • Ensure roll-ups are tightly rolled to prevent them from unrolling during baking.
  • Using a toothpick helps secure the roll so it keeps its shape.
